Active Heated Chamber

A heated chamber facilitates the manufacturing of engineering polymers by maintaining the proper temperature for the printable part throughout the printing process. This temperature control helps with the uniform construction of the part, minimizing the formation of internal stresses. Heating the chamber promotes relaxation and eliminates internal tensions during manufacturing, effectively avoiding issues like warping and cracking. All of this allows for high dimensional accuracy and mechanical durability for the printed part. The BCN3D Omega I60 heated chamber can reach temperatures of up to 70ºC (158 ºF), making it great for printing materials such as ASA, PA, ABS and reinforced PA, among others.

Massive Print Volume

The printing volume available in the BCN3D Omega I60 is 450 x 300 x 450 mm (17.7 x 11.8 x 17.7 in), offering up to 60 liters. This, combined with the heated chamber, gives BCN3D Omega I60 the ability to produce large technical parts.

IDEX

IDEX stands out as the sole extrusion system with the unique capability of printing using two independent heads. Users can double productivity with duplication and mirror modes or produce parts with support without cross-contamination. BCN3D Omega I60 is equipped with a refined IDEX technology, where the X motors remain stationary during the printing process. This design feature minimizes inertia, resulting in accelerated print speeds.

HAQ-XY Kinematics

BCN3D Omega I60 utilizes a custom HAQ-XY Kinematics system. This motion architecture is considered one of the better systems for dual 3D printers and CNC machines, as it provides a lightweight, robust and precise approach. BCN3D Omega I60 equips an improved version of this kinematics by placing the pulleys in a slightly different position. As a result, the system experiences a significant reduction in twisting moments along the X axis during the printing process. These twisting moments are highly undesirable as they can have detrimental effects on the system's performance and potentially lead to deformations in the X axis, thereby negatively impacting the quality of the printed parts.

XYZ Assisted Calibration

This technology, which uses piezoelectric sensors, eliminates much of the human interaction and allows for proper first-layer adhesion. It calibrates by measuring multiple points to adjust the height of the print surface (Z) and the offset (XY) between the nozzles.

Uninterruptible Power Supply (UPS)

The UPS provides protection for equipment and work against power outages. With the UPS, the 3D printer can automatically resume the printing process once the power is restored during a blackout.
